Job summary
Join SickKids as a Clinical Trials Project Manager focused on pediatric oncology. Manage critical clinical research efforts and contribute to groundbreaking therapies for children in a hybrid work setup. Be part of The Hospital for Sick Children’s dedicated team as a Clinical Research Project Manager within the Clinical Trials Support Unit. In this role, you will manage a portfolio of complex oncology trials while supporting the STEP-1 Program and the U-Link Canada initiative. Work collaboratively with healthcare teams to enhance the trial process and ensure equity in access for pediatric patients.
